Asivada Population - PanchMahal, Gujarat

Asivada is a medium size village located in Santrampur Taluka of PanchMahal district, Gujarat with total 53 families residing. The Asivada village has population of 247 of which 124 are males while 123 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Asivada village population of children with age 0-6 is 21 which makes up 8.50 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Asivada village is 992 which is higher than Gujarat state average of 919. Child Sex Ratio for the Asivada as per census is 1333, higher than Gujarat average of 890.

Asivada village has lower literacy rate compared to Gujarat. In 2011, literacy rate of Asivada village was 73.45 % compared to 78.03 % of Gujarat. In Asivada Male literacy stands at 93.04 % while female literacy rate was 53.15 %.

Caste Factor

In Asivada village, most of the village population is from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 95.95 % of total population in Asivada village. There is no population of Schedule Caste (SC) in Asivada village of PanchMahal.

Work Profile

In Asivada village out of total population, 94 were engaged in work activities. 41.49 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 58.51 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 94 workers engaged in Main Work, 30 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 0 were Agricultural labourer.
